I watched alarm clocks waking the sleepers for 2 hours- Great time period to watch the piece. On the cusp of waking/dreaming/sleeping and the dark into the sunrise- In india they call it Navaswann- the wave of waking before dawn. If you are up before sunrise and you hear the first bird chirp- you're on the wave- supposedly rising with the wave gives you great energy..<br /><br />Anyway, it was cool because i walked out around seven and the sun was just starting to come up and the streets were still quiet empty. I noticed<br />a palpable, wonderful, soft peacefulness as i walked and realized that after watching 2 hours of manic cutting, alarms, nightmares,(all totally absorbing, addictive and cool as hell!) there was an unexpected gift from the piece. Afterwards, I experienced a feeling that my own life, with it's uncut, seamless unity, was restored to me and I felt more inside my own body than i had before seeing the piece. That is a pretty great gift I think.<br /><br />Wish I could have gone back and seen another time, but happy I was there then..Anonymousn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4865764596112100655.post-56731619633276510862011-02-20T12:41:09.166-05:002011-02-20T12:41:09.166-05:00I went and saw 'The Clock' at the White Cu...I went and saw 'The Clock' at the White Cube in London three times, the final time for over 2 hours and even then I could have stayed indefinitely.
